Transaction b809007553415c8d32755eb652f98efaebcca836728f376441a41ba39cc77647
1 Input
1 Output
-
b809007553415c8d32755eb652f98efaebcca836728f376441a41ba39cc77647:0
- value
- 22890560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a19f9e5166c770eb0e9cf52680ed4040ad11c2b OP_EQUAL
- address
- 36zEEXNySApaRNmZwbCDMd2xcSGMWyUwDN